Facial injuries – hunter (83) hit colleagues while shooting hare

Date:

Unlucky shot Saturday morning in Eggerding. An 83-year-old hunter wanted to shoot a brown hare, but hit a younger colleague in the face and thigh. The injured man was flown to hospital by helicopter, but his life is not in danger.

An 83-year-old hunter from St. Marienkirchen near Schärding took part in a hunt in Eggerding on Saturday. When a brown hare ran out of the forest around 9.25 am, he fired a shot from the edge of the forest with his double rifle. He encountered a 50-year-old from Mayrhof who was standing about 73 meters away from the shooter. After receiving emergency medical treatment, the 50-year-old was flown by rescue helicopter to Ried im Innkreis hospital with injuries of an undetermined nature.
